Output 666c70eaaf1bb8e55e297b74c9c8e42e15103e60c0141e01c06497ad8f448a6e:0

value
593700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 169675613b6ea968584f54361b75e645ba878273 OP_EQUAL
address
33kT2odyBGvcpbUSjZGos3bWihM7H4tToS
transaction
666c70eaaf1bb8e55e297b74c9c8e42e15103e60c0141e01c06497ad8f448a6e
spent
true